Legend of ‘El Santo’ lives on |
MEXICO CITY — A white statue of a masked, muscular figure gleams under the hot sun as a river of motor vehicles flows by. The statue was erected in 1985 near the city’s infamous Tepito market to honor Mexico’s most celebrated wrestler/Lucha Libre film action star, El Santo (the Saint), also know as El Enmascarado de Plata (the Silver Mask) because of the silver mask he wore.
